Festa heads to National Spelling Bee for second time

April 7, 2016

Fourteen-year-old Lela Festa of Still River Road won the North Central Massachusetts Regional Spelling Bee on March 22. She beat out 24 other local students and will now head to Washington, D.C., to compete in the Scripps National Spelling Bee in May for the second time, after winning last year’s regional bee, too. Festa is an eighth-grader at the Immaculate Heart of Mary School in Still River.
